package android.support.transition;
import android.os.Build;
import android.support.annotation.NonNull;
import android.support.annotation.Nullable;
import android.view.ViewGroup;
/**
* This class manages the set of transitions that fire when there is a
* change of {@link Scene}. To use the manager, add scenes along with
* transition objects with calls to {@link #setTransition(Scene, Transition)}
* or {@link #setTransition(Scene, Scene, Transition)}. Setting specific
* transitions for scene changes is not required; by default, a Scene change
* will use {@link AutoTransition} to do something reasonable for most
* situations. Specifying other transitions for particular scene changes is
* only necessary if the application wants different transition behavior
* in these situations.
*
* <p>Unlike the platform version, this does not support declaration by XML resources.</p>
*/
public class TransitionManager {
private static TransitionManagerStaticsImpl sImpl;
static {
if (Build.VERSION.SDK_INT < 19) {
sImpl = new TransitionManagerStaticsIcs();
} else {
sImpl = new TransitionManagerStaticsKitKat();
}
}
private TransitionManagerImpl mImpl;
public TransitionManager() {
if (Build.VERSION.SDK_INT < 19) {
mImpl = new TransitionManagerIcs();
} else {
mImpl = new TransitionManagerKitKat();
}
}
/**
* Convenience method to simply change to the given scene using
* the default transition for TransitionManager.
*
* @param scene The Scene to change to
*/
public static void go(@NonNull Scene scene) {
sImpl.go(scene.mImpl);
}
/**
* Convenience method to simply change to the given scene using
* the given transition.
*
* <p>Passing in <code>null</code> for the transition parameter will
* result in the scene changing without any transition running, and is
* equivalent to calling {@link Scene#exit()} on the scene root's
* current scene, followed by {@link Scene#enter()} on the scene
* specified by the <code>scene</code> parameter.</p>
*
* @param scene The Scene to change to
* @param transition The transition to use for this scene change. A
* value of null causes the scene change to happen with no transition.
*/
public static void go(@NonNull Scene scene, @Nullable Transition transition) {
sImpl.go(scene.mImpl, transition == null ? null : transition.mImpl);
}
/**
* Convenience method to animate, using the default transition,
* to a new scene defined by all changes within the given scene root between
* calling this method and the next rendering frame.
* Equivalent to calling {@link #beginDelayedTransition(ViewGroup, Transition)}
* with a value of <code>null</code> for the <code>transition</code> parameter.
*
* @param sceneRoot The root of the View hierarchy to run the transition on.
*/
public static void beginDelayedTransition(@NonNull final ViewGroup sceneRoot) {
sImpl.beginDelayedTransition(sceneRoot);
}
/**
* Convenience method to animate to a new scene defined by all changes within
* the given scene root between calling this method and the next rendering frame.
* Calling this method causes TransitionManager to capture current values in the
* scene root and then post a request to run a transition on the next frame.
* At that time, the new values in the scene root will be captured and changes
* will be animated. There is no need to create a Scene; it is implied by
* changes which take place between calling this method and the next frame when
* the transition begins.
*
* <p>Calling this method several times before the next frame (for example, if
* unrelated code also wants to make dynamic changes and run a transition on
* the same scene root), only the first call will trigger capturing values
* and exiting the current scene. Subsequent calls to the method with the
* same scene root during the same frame will be ignored.</p>
*
* <p>Passing in <code>null</code> for the transition parameter will
* cause the TransitionManager to use its default transition.</p>
*
* @param sceneRoot The root of the View hierarchy to run the transition on.
* @param transition The transition to use for this change. A
* value of null causes the TransitionManager to use the default transition.
*/
public static void beginDelayedTransition(@NonNull final ViewGroup sceneRoot,
@Nullable Transition transition) {
sImpl.beginDelayedTransition(sceneRoot, transition == null ? null : transition.mImpl);
}
/**
* Sets a specific transition to occur when the given scene is entered.
*
* @param scene The scene which, when applied, will cause the given
* transition to run.
* @param transition The transition that will play when the given scene is
* entered. A value of null will result in the default behavior of
* using the default transition instead.
*/
public void setTransition(@NonNull Scene scene, @Nullable Transition transition) {
mImpl.setTransition(scene.mImpl, transition == null ? null : transition.mImpl);
}
/**
* Sets a specific transition to occur when the given pair of scenes is
* exited/entered.
*
* @param fromScene The scene being exited when the given transition will
* be run
* @param toScene The scene being entered when the given transition will
* be run
* @param transition The transition that will play when the given scene is
* entered. A value of null will result in the default behavior of
* using the default transition instead.
*/
public void setTransition(@NonNull Scene fromScene, @NonNull Scene toScene,
@Nullable Transition transition) {
mImpl.setTransition(fromScene.mImpl, toScene.mImpl,
transition == null ? null : transition.mImpl);
}
/**
* Change to the given scene, using the
* appropriate transition for this particular scene change
* (as specified to the TransitionManager, or the default
* if no such transition exists).
*
* @param scene The Scene to change to
*/
public void transitionTo(@NonNull Scene scene) {
mImpl.transitionTo(scene.mImpl);
}
}
